Azerbaijan, Baku, Feb 22/ Trend A.Akhundov/
Azerbaijan will begin fixing the state border with border signs in the near future, State Committee of Land and Cartography Chairman Garib Mammadov said at the committee's meeting on Wednesday.
"Specialists from the committee are actively involved in the process of re-demarcating the Azerbaijani-Iranian border and protecting the shore protection. Azerbaijani and Iranian specialists are working together and participating regularly in bilateral meetings." he said.
The border delimitation works with Georgia have not yet been completed.
"The experts hold regular meetings and work on measuring the border line. The length of the Azerbaijani-Georgian border is 480 km, of which 280 km are coordinated by state commissions", he added.
The process of demarcating the 390 km border with Russia ended in 2011.
